St Patrick's Day Weekend

Celebrate St Patrick's Day weekend at Mount Stewart with delicious traditional food, a Irish mythology family friendly garden tour and the perfect photo op in the Shamrock Garden.

  • Booking not needed
  • Free event (admission applies)

Join us on St Patrick's Day weekend for a family friendly garden tour and discover the stories behind the curious statues in the formal gardens, steeped in Irish and world mythology. Then head over to the tea-room to sample some traditional Irish and Northern Irish cuisines including Stew, Wheaten Bread and not forgetting a good old Fifteen.

Garden Tour is free, sign up at reception on arrival.

Garden Tours take place at:

11am-11.45am 12pm-12.45pm 1.15pm-2pm 2.15pm-3pm
